3 Key Advantages of Listing Your Home Before Spring Hits

Most sellers wait until spring to list, but that’s when competition is highest. Planning early and making simple updates can give your home a real advantage.

 

Are you thinking about selling your home this spring? Here’s a quick tip: start the process now. Most homeowners wait until March or April, but getting a head start gives you a real advantage. Let me break down the three biggest reasons why.

1. It takes longer than you think. Before your home hits the market, there’s a lot to prepare: photos, staging decisions, repairs, touch-ups, decluttering, and sometimes even a pre-inspection. Starting early gives you room to make thoughtful updates without rushing, and those updates can directly boost your sale price.

2. You beat the spring rush. Spring is when everyone lists at once. By starting now, we can position your home to go live right before the peak. That’s when buyer demand is already building, inventory is still low, and offers tend to be stronger.

 

"Starting early helps your home shine before the spring rush even begins."


3. You get a clear, stress-free plan. When you reach out early, we can map out your ideal timeline, connect you with trusted vendors, and review the current market trends together. By the time spring arrives, everything is already handled. You don’t need to scramble or make last-minute decisions. Instead, you experience a smooth, confident launch.

Top 5 Things To Do in Asheville This Holiday Season

From the Biltmore lights to cozy cocoa on Main Street, Asheville transforms into a winter wonderland, making the city feel truly magical.

 

If you’re planning to visit during the holidays, you’ll love Asheville in December. From glittering lights to snowy mountain views, this city feels like it was made for the holidays. Here are a few of my favorite festive things to do around town this season:

1. Biltmore Estate. Nothing says “holiday magic” like the Biltmore at Christmas. The estate glows with thousands of twinkling lights, dozens of themed trees, and roaring fireplaces that feel straight out of a holiday movie. And don’t miss the unforgettable Candlelight Christmas Evenings.

2. Winter Lights at the North Carolina Arboretum. Just minutes from downtown, the Winter Lights display at the Arboretum is one of Asheville’s most beloved traditions. Imagine illuminated gardens, glowing pathways, and plenty of spots to snap a family photo.

3. Asheville holiday parade and downtown festivities. Downtown Asheville transforms into a festive wonderland this time of year. The holiday parade, local shops, and art galleries make for the perfect winter day. Grab a cup of hot cocoa, wander past the twinkling window displays, and feel the community spirit that makes Asheville so unique.

4. Blue Ridge Parkway. It’s beautiful any time of year, but in winter, it’s something else entirely. You’ll see frosted trees, panoramic views, and peaceful stretches of mountain road that make it a perfect weekend drive. Just remember to check for snow or ice closures before heading out.

5. Wolf Ridge Resort. If you’re craving adventure, Wolf Ridge Resort is just a short trip from downtown Asheville. Skiing, snowboarding, and tubing are all on the menu, plus, it’s one of the few places nearby where you can experience true mountain snow fun without driving too far.

What makes Asheville so magical during the holidays is the feeling it gives you. Whether it’s sharing cocoa by the fire, exploring the River Arts District, or simply taking in the views, this city wraps you in warmth and wonder all season long.

Asheville Market Update: Prices, Days on Market & What’s Next

Home prices in the Asheville area remain steady, but rising inventory and longer days on the market are reshaping what it takes to sell in 2025.

 

Asheville’s housing market is in a new phase. It’s more balanced than last year, but still showing steady value growth.

Across Buncombe County, the average time on market has stretched to about a month. That’s up from last year’s fast-paced sales and reflects an important shift: buyers now have breathing room. Here’s what you need to know.

 

Inventory is climbing toward balance. Right now, the region has roughly four to six months of inventory. That’s the tipping point between a seller’s and a buyer’s market. Once supply crosses six months, it leans in favor of buyers. While Asheville hasn’t fully reached that stage, it’s close enough to influence how homes are priced and negotiated.


More price reductions. These aren’t necessarily signs of a crash; they’re simply a correction. Many sellers are still pricing their homes with a 2022 mindset, expecting multiple offers overnight. Today, pricing aggressively from day one matters more than ever to avoid “chasing the market” later.


"
Prices are holding strong and even trending up in several areas."


Prices are still trending upward.
Prices are holding strong and even trending up in several areas. Homeowners still have healthy equity, and values continue to show long-term strength. Despite higher inventory, demand remains steady from local buyers and people relocating to the mountains for lifestyle and investment reasons.

Advice for home sellers: Price smart and stay flexible. Even with equity growth, sellers should avoid overpricing. Homes that start too high often sit, leading to deeper cuts later. Listing at or slightly below market value can spark interest faster and attract stronger offers.

Advice for homebuyers: Now’s a great time to explore your options. The market finally offers breathing room. With more homes to choose from and fewer bidding wars, it’s a great time to negotiate, request repairs, or explore homes that may have been out of reach before.

Overall, Asheville’s market is healthy. It means stability, steady growth, and a return to realistic pricing that benefits everyone.

Should You Accept Crypto or Tokenized Real Estate Offers?

Would you sell your home for Bitcoin or Ethereum? Before you say yes to a crypto or tokenized offer, I’ll go over the pros, cons, and legal hurdles, plus how to know when it’s worth accepting and when to walk away.


If someone wanted to buy your property with Bitcoin, Ethereum, or shares in a tokenized property, would you take it? One of my seller clients just faced a first: a full-price offer on their property, paid in Ethereum. They were excited at first, but then came the reality check.

Crypto and tokenized real estate sound futuristic, but there’s a lot you need to understand before you accept one of these offers. Let me walk you through what these offers mean, the risks involved, and when it might make sense to say yes.

1. Crypto offers are fast, flexible, but wildly volatile. Homebuyers using crypto are often tech-savvy and ready to close quickly, sometimes even without traditional bank financing. And that can be appealing until you remember that crypto values can swing wildly overnight.

Cryptocurrency values can swing wildly. What’s worth $500,000 today could drop to $440,000 in a week. That’s why many sellers who accept crypto choose to convert it into U.S. dollars right at contract signing, often through an escrow service or crypto-to-cash platform. It locks in your sale price and removes the risk of last-minute value changes.

2. Tokenized real estate is still new. Tokenized real estate breaks a property into digital “shares,” like a stock, that can be bought and sold on a blockchain platform. While it’s an interesting model, especially in commercial and fractional property investment, it’s not yet common in most residential sales. Many lenders, title companies, and legal frameworks aren’t fully set up for it.


"
Crypto and tokenized offers are becoming more common, but they’re not right for every seller."


If you’re a seller, a tokenized offer might sound modern, but this could mean slower closings or tricky legal questions. Unless you have a legal team or brokerage experienced in blockchain real estate, approach these offers with caution.

3. Taxes and titles can get complicated. The IRS treats crypto as property, not currency or cash. That means accepting Bitcoin or Ethereum for your home triggers capital gains tracking and extra paperwork.

For buyers, many title and escrow companies still aren’t set up to handle crypto smoothly. This means that if the funds aren’t converted to cash, some title and escrow companies won’t know how to process the deal.

Before saying “yes,” talk to a tax professional and choose a title company that’s already handled digital asset deals. It can save you a major headache later.

4. Expect a different buyer profile. Crypto and tokenized homebuyers often come from international or younger investors who are deeply engaged in digital finance. However, they may be unfamiliar with U.S. real estate processes, which can lead to miscommunication or unexpected delays.

If you’re considering one of these offers, work with an agent experienced in crypto transactions. They can help set clear expectations and ensure all the tech and paperwork behind the scenes runs smoothly.

Is it worth the risk? Crypto and tokenized offers are becoming more common, but they’re not right for every seller. If you get one, slow down, ask questions, and get advice from professionals who understand this space.
